The staging and production instances of the Emberline firmware update channel have drifted. Staging was bumped to a shorter polling interval and a larger rollout cohort during last month's canary work, and the changes were never reverted or promoted, so behaviour now differs in ways that make canary results misleading. Proposal: promote the cohort size, revert the polling interval, and add a drift check to CI. Reviewer, please compare against production, which currently runs with the following configuration.

settings of bawif-fawif:
ralix:
  log_level: warn
  metrics_host: metrics.ralix.tolvaqsys.internal
  pool_size: 32

## Authentication

The thumbnail queue (Thumbelisk) won't accept jobs without a valid service credential — anonymous enqueues got abused once and never again. When reviewing queue-related PRs, check that the client reads the credential from config, never from a literal. For local testing against the staging queue, use the key provided below.

service key, tadup-tahog: zpat7_wB1tnEL

### Step 4: Recreate the replica lag alarm

After cutting Pondera over to the new read replicas, the old lag alarm will stop firing — it watched the retired host. Recreate it against the new replica set before closing the ticket, or support will be blind to lag. Apply the alarm with exactly these values.

service settings:
WENOX_PIN=1918
WENOX_METRICS_HOST=metrics.wenox.lumicworks.corp
WENOX_LOG_LEVEL=info
WENOX_TENANT=belion

Before signing off a release, confirm that the report builder's multi-column sort remains stable. The engine must preserve the original row order for equal keys; a regression here silently reorders grouped financial rows. Run the canned stability suite against the staging dataset, then manually sort the "regional summary" template by two columns and compare against the golden snapshot. Any diff, even cosmetic, blocks the release. Record your verification alongside the build token shown below.

pipeline stamp: htk6_35e0c9